Pompeo accuses says al Qaeda has new home in Iran, gives no hard evidence

U.S. Secretary of State Mike Pompeo announced on Tuesday, without giving hard proof, that al Qaeda had built a new home base in Iran and the United States had fewer opportunities in dealing with the group now it was “burrowed inside” that country

Pompeo said the U.S will add new sanctions on Iran over its claimed links to Al-Qaeda. He added that Tehran’s intelligence ministry aids Al-Qaeda while the organization “protects” Iran.

He affirmed that the Iran-Al-Qaeda link is a “massive force for evil across the world” and went on to accuse Tehran of helping plan the 9/11 attacks on the US.
